Use "take some —" in a sentence | "take some —" example sentences

How to use "take some —" in a sentence?

  • Take some time off to go within, in silence. With that, your charm becomes eternal, your love becomes unconditional & great strength arises.
    -Sri Sri Ravi Shankar-
  • Connecting with people is not hard. I love the interaction and the feedback after shows. It does take some time, but the fans appreciate it which makes it worth it.
    -Gabriel Iglesias-
  • Lord, give me a sense of humor so that I may take some happiness from this life and share it with others.
    -Thomas More-
  • Wherever there is sincerity & talent, people do recognize them. It may take some time but we should have some patience and hold on to our passion.
    -Sri Sri Ravi Shankar-
  • Molly was committing dinner by that time, aided and abetted by Sanya, who seemed to take some kind of grim Russian delight in watching train wrecks in progress.
    -Jim Butcher-
  • We thought that if we can highlight it, it will impact policy-makers and politicians and encourage them to take some concrete action.
    -Murari Lal Sharma-
  • In the best of all worlds, the producers would take some responsibility for the kinds of things they're putting out. Unfortunately, they don't.
    -Dick Van Dyke-
  • You can't say the public likes generic characters. Give others a chance, go for a more rooted and honest characterisation, take some risk, and then let the public choose.
    -Randeep Hooda-
